Guest guest Posted January 9, 2009 Report Share Posted January 9, 2009 According to botanical point of view, oudh or agarwood trees can be divided into several familia and genus. From it's familia the agarwood or oudh trees were divided into 3 kinds of familia the first is the Thymeleaceae. This familia had several genus the first is Aetoxylon, the second is Aquillaria, the third is Enklenia, the fourth is Gonystylus, the fifth is Wikstroemia (use to be found in Java, now extinct because exessive hunting during the Dutch colonial era.) the sixth is Grynops.
